This is correct when the paths refer to > something in STAGING_DIR (e.g. libdir, includedir), but not when it > refers to something used for the target. > > alsa-utils uses the udevdir variable from udev.pc to decide where to > install things. Since DESTDIR is prepended to the install destination, > this will end up in the wrong location. > > Until a better solution is found in pkgconf, pass the udevrulesdir to > use explicitly instead of relying on udev.pc. > > Fixes: > - http://autobuild.buildroot.org/results/d8ad140ae52b4fe8e153de3835f3f17e92b58e53 > > Signed-off-by: Fabrice Fontaine > --- > package/alsa-utils/alsa-utils.mk | 5 +++++ > 1 file changed, 5 insertions(+) > > diff --git a/package/alsa-utils/alsa-utils.mk b/package/alsa-utils/alsa-utils.mk > index 0bf2b432bd..422318796f 100644 > --- a/package/alsa-utils/alsa-utils.mk > +++ b/package/alsa-utils/alsa-utils.mk > @@ -28,6 +28,11 @@ ALSA_UTILS_CONF_OPTS = \ > --disable-rst2man \ > --with-curses=$(if $(BR2_PACKAGE_NCURSES_WCHAR),ncursesw,ncurses) > > +ifeq ($(BR2_PACKAGE_HAS_UDEV),y) > +ALSA_UTILS_CONF_OPTS += --with-udev-rules-dir=/usr/lib/udev/rules.d > +ALSA_UTILS_DEPENDENCIES += udev Is there a build time dependency of alsa-utils on udev? As far as I can see alsa-utils only installs the .rules file, so the order of build should not matter. > +endif > + > ifeq ($(BR2_PACKAGE_ALSA_UTILS_ALSALOOP),y) > ALSA_UTILS_CONF_OPTS += --enable-alsaloop > else baruch -- http://baruch.siach.name/blog/ ~. .~ Tk Open Systems =}------------------------------------------------ooO--U--Ooo------------{= - baruch at tkos.co.il - tel: +972.52.368.4656, http://www.tkos.co.il -
